    Who is Dr. Stone, Pediatrician in Savannah, GA?

    Dr. Dudley Stone, MD is a Pediatrician, who primarily practices in Savannah, GA. He has been practicing for over 24 years and is board certified by the American Board of Pediatrics. Dr. Stone graduated from Medical College of Georgia at Georgia Regents University and completed his residency at Memorial Health Pediatric Residency. Dr. Stone is fluent in English, Arabic, and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Stone’s practice accepts Medicaid, UnitedHealthcare, Aetna, Cigna and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Dudley Stone's specialty?

    Dr. Stone is a Pediatrician near Savannah, GA.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.     Is this Dr. Dudley Stone aff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Stone is affiliated with St. Joseph's Hospital - Savannah, GA which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
